What is a Computer Use Agent?

A computer-use agent is an AI system designed to interact with software and digital environments just as a human would. Instead of simply generating text, images, or code, these agents can navigate interfaces, execute commands, manipulate files, and automate workflowsβ€”all without human intervention.

Unlike traditional AI chatbots that rely on human prompts for guidance, a computer-use agent can independently complete tasks within a digital workspace, making it a step closer to true automation.


How Computer-Use Agents Work

  1. Observe and Learn from Human Demonstrations

    • Instead of training on static datasets, computer-use agents are trained by watching humans perform real-world tasks on a computer.

    • These tasks can include anything from filling out forms to adjusting software settings or running multi-step operations.

  2. Mimic and Automate Digital Workflows

    • Once trained, the agent can replicate those actions automatically.

    • It understands the sequence of steps needed to complete a task and executes them autonomously.

  3. Adapt to New Interfaces and Workflows

    • Unlike rigid automation scripts, computer-use agents can generalize knowledge, meaning they can adapt to different software environments even if the layout or options change.

  4. Perform Tasks as a Virtual Worker

    • These agents function as AI-powered digital workers, replacing manual effort in various industries.

    • They can integrate with multiple applications, allowing businesses and individuals to offload repetitive tasks.


Examples of Computer-Use Agents in Action

πŸ”Ή Customer Support Automation

  • An AI agent can navigate customer service portals, generate responses, and resolve tickets without human oversight.

πŸ”Ή Data Processing & Entry

  • Instead of manually inputting data, a computer-use agent can extract information from emails, spreadsheets, or forms and enter it into a database.

πŸ”Ή Software Configuration & Management

  • Users can train an agent to modify software settings, update configurations, or automate routine IT tasks like clearing cache or managing permissions.

πŸ”Ή Market Research & Online Search Automation

  • Instead of manually researching competitors, an agent can crawl websites, extract relevant data, and compile reports automatically.

πŸ”Ή Shopping and Participating in E-Commerce

  • A user can ask a computer-use agent to order them something from an E-commerce website, like new AA batteries from Amazon.
